瞄准是轻武器射击三大要素的中心环节,是准确射击的重点。在射击中,不少射手由于不能采用较科学的瞄准方法来平正准星缺口以及把握正确的瞄准景况。而使射弹产生偏差。采用视线回收放射瞄准法,就能较好地解决这一问题。 所谓视线回收放射瞄准法,是首先对目标进行概略瞄准,然后将视线回收到近处的准星缺口处,进行第二次平正准星缺口,最后再将视线转移到目标瞄准点上,形成正确的瞄准景况。采用这种方法,可以保持良好的视力清晰程度,快捷地检查和修正瞄准,提高瞄准
